Thrive Causemetics & Beauty 2 the Streetz Parttner

— December 27, 2025 — Social Good
The cosmetic brand Thrive Causemetics and the nonprofit organization Beauty 2 The Streetz joined forces to run a large-scale volunteer event on Giving Tuesday at a college campus in Long Beach. The activity involved a team of brand representatives, beauty professionals, and community advocates who provided meals, distributed hygiene kits, and conducted a makeup tutorial for more than a thousand individuals experiencing homelessness. Notable participants included Ayesha Perry, Erica Taylor, and Zaina Sesay.

Karissa Bodnar, Founder + CEO of Thrive Causemetics®, confirmed: “This initiative is about much more than beauty. s we celebrate a decade of impact, we reflect on the power that community can create when we show up for one another.”

The partnership between Thrive Causemetics and Beauty 2 The Streetz is long-standing. The beauty company has contributed over one and a half million dollars in monetary and product donations to the nonprofit since 2017.
